1. Establish a Clear and Realistic Budget
One of the most important steps to mastering your business finances is to establish a clear and realistic budget. This means knowing all your income and expenses, as well as setting spending and investment goals. A good budget will help you control your costs, identify savings opportunities, and ensure you have enough resources to keep your business running healthily.

2. Maintain Strict Cash Flow Control
Cash flow is the movement of money in and out of your business. It is essential to maintain strict control over cash flow to ensure you have enough resources to pay your bills and invest in the company’s growth. Closely monitoring the inflows and outflows of money will allow you to identify financial problems before they become major issues.

4. Negotiate with Suppliers and Partners
One of the most effective ways to improve your business finances is to negotiate with suppliers and partners. Always seek the best conditions and prices for the products and services you use, and be open to negotiating payment terms and discounts. These small savings can make a big difference in your bottom line and help increase your company’s profitability.
5. Be Prepared for Unexpected Events
No matter how well-planned your business is, unexpected events can happen at any time. It is crucial to be prepared to handle emergency situations, such as the loss of an important client, equipment breakdown, or an economic crisis. Always have an emergency reserve to ensure continuity of operations and avoid negative financial impacts on your business.
